In the morning, when the temperature is 286 K , a bicyclist finds that the gauge pressure in his tires is 404 kPa . That afternoon she finds that the pressure in the tires has increased to 422 kPa .
Part A What is the afternoon temperature?

Answer:

The answer is 298.74K

Explanation:

Ideal gas formula is following:

[tex]P*V=n*R*T[/tex]

We are assuming that, except temperature and pressure, all other variables are constant. So if we define morning temperature and pressure as:

[tex]T_{0}=286K\\P_{0}=404kPa[/tex]

Then if we write the same formula for afternoon time the equation will be:

[tex]P_{1}*V=n*R*T_{1}\\1.045*P_{0}*V=n*R*T_{1}[/tex]

Then we find out that the must be correlation between morning and afternoon temperature as following:

[tex]T_{1}=1.045*T_{0}\\T_{1}=1.045*286\\T_{1}=298.74K[/tex]
